The direct pursuit of happiness is itself toxic, as it inevitably leads to abusing others once all other avenues no longer provide the "fix" they used to. Like many drugs, people become resistant to their sources of happiness and require more and more intense sources to achieve the same amount of happiness. That inevitably leads to abuse as the only means of self-satisfaction.
The only correct action is to never directly pursue happiness, but to find happiness while doing other things. |
